Output ddcbeb8513f7fa6171a87ef9f5f0d8c983e77455b9e74da271c3901083cdf369:2

value
20274
script pubkey
OP_0 OP_PUSHBYTES_20 61e390b52bd5210f85b3836c381a4ebecb49709d
address
tb1qv83epdft65sslpdnsdkrsxjwhm95juya52xyju
transaction
ddcbeb8513f7fa6171a87ef9f5f0d8c983e77455b9e74da271c3901083cdf369
confirmations
59590
spent
true